What Is Titration?

In pharmacology, titration adhd Medications refers to the steady adjustment of medication does based upon patient-specific responses. This process is frequently used in various treatments, such as handling chronic discomfort, changing insulin levels in diabetes, or tweak psychiatric medications. Titration ADHD Adults intends to find the optimal dose that efficiently handles symptoms while decreasing side effects.

Key Objectives of Titration:

  • Efficacy: To guarantee the medication successfully resolves the patient's symptoms.
  • Security: To prevent unfavorable adverse effects and guarantee patient comfort.
  • Individualization: To tailor the treatment for each individual based on their special response to the medication.

The Titration Waiting List Explained

In lots of health care systems, especially those involving specialized medications or treatments, patients might discover themselves on a Titration Waiting List. This list includes clients who need to wait on an ideal chance to finalize their medication dose changes. It can be aggravating, specifically for those needing instant treatment; nevertheless, it serves a number of functions that ultimately benefit patient care.

Factors for a Titration Waiting List

  1. Resource Allocation: Medical practitioners have actually restricted time and resources. The waiting list assists focus on care based on urgency and medical requirement.
  2. Vigilance and Monitoring: More complex or high-risk titrations require thorough tracking. A waiting list enables health care suppliers time to assess current patients before onboarding new ones.
  3. Client Safety: Sudden modifications in medication does can result in severe side results. A waiting list guarantees that patients receive attention in a systematic and safe way.

How Titration Waiting Lists Work

The functioning of a Titration Waiting List can vary across healthcare institutions. Nevertheless, patients can typically anticipate the following:

  1. Assessment: Upon prescription, a healthcare expert will examine the need for titration.
  2. Wait Notification: Patients will get alert if they are placed on a waiting list, detailing approximated wait times and what to anticipate throughout the process.
  3. Regular Updates: Patients may receive updates concerning their position on the waiting list and any changes in anticipated timelines.
  4. Follow-Up Appointments: Regular check-ins with health care service providers may be arranged to examine general health and interim symptom management.
